We’re supporting our client in hiring a highly organised and proactive Interview Scheduler & HR Administrator to join the People team on an interim basis. This role is ideal for someone who thrives in a fast-paced environment, enjoys coordination work, and is confident managing multiple moving parts.
You’ll play a key role in supporting hiring processes, scheduling interviews, maintaining people data, and delivering excellent admin support across the HR function.
The RoleIn this hands‑on role, you will be responsible for coordinating interview scheduling across busy diaries, supporting with manual administrative processes, and helping the team run smoothly through a period of high activity. You’ll need to be highly organised, detail‑focused, and able to quickly figure things out independently.
Key Responsibilities- Schedule interviews across multiple stakeholders and time zones, managing diaries manually and ensuring a smooth candidate experience.
- Act as the central point of contact for hiring managers, recruiters, and candidates regarding scheduling and logistics.
- Support general HR administration, including maintaining people records, updating systems, and supporting documentation workflows.
- Assist with data entry and upkeep of the People database and ATS.
- Deliver accurate and timely admin support, ensuring processes run efficiently.
- Troubleshoot scheduling challenges and proactively resolve issues independently.
- Support ad‑hoc People team tasks as needed during peak periods.
